Purim is celebrating in Jewish tradition to represent God's(by means of Queen Esther and Mordicai) deliverance of the Jews from the evil Hamen, found in the book of Esther. It is a gathering where children dress up as queen Esther, Mordicai or Hamen. They come to hear the story of Esther and when the name of Hamen is mentioned they use groggers (noise makers) to blot out his name when it is read. The other big part of the festival is to drink into the oblivion (but we are going to leave that part out).
